The Hierarchy of Internet Needs mirrors Maslow's Hierarchy of Needs just closely enough to be a tad scary but it's all in good fun. I concur with all but the need for pictures and videos of cats. Actually I'll concede the cat point, particularly when a Roomba is involved - it's so ridiculous that "Roomba Cat" is one the top search term suggestions by Google when you start typing Roomba into its search box. But I really  don't get it. Chinchilla's, penguins and so many other animal are so much cuter and amusing.  


The Addiction Chart covers Porn, Coffee, Cigarettes, Alcohol, the Internet, Fast Food, Gambling and Apple Products. Humorously laying out when/how each addiction got started, when it became a problem, the time it was at its worst, its support group and finally when you know it's been kicked.
